Who's team are you copying? How do you know it is any good and not just lucky that one time you studied it? Only 5 players have won more than 800 tournaments and they are playing gold not iron. Because you can win a tournament in gold in 1 hour vs. 3 in iron and 6 in bronze.

If you want to be good in iron you need to study (copy) players that are good in iron. So, you need to enter daily early or late iron and find the teams that are tops in iron. For best results study (copy) the hitters from one team and study (copy) the pitchers from a different team to create your very own unique team.

And don't forget there is a lot of luck involved.

Let's assume that all 16 teams have the identical roster with the identical strategy ... 8 teams have to get knocked out in the first round and one team has to win.

I had stretches where in 10 tourneys I won a couple and had a few second place finishes, followed by lots of early exits while fielding exactly the same team.

But obviously, when you never win (or finish second), there must be something you're missing

Other things that are not shown when viewing another team's roster:

pitch counts and batters faced counts;
fatigue settings and how often bench players play (if at all);
secondary bullpen roles;
use of openers and opener lineups.

Some of these can be gleaned from studying the team's stats, some can be estimated or guesstimated, and some are just plain unknowable.
